Violin Outreach Program (VOP)

VOP Performance classes will explore musical performance and refine mastery strategies and skills.

Our expert instructors will teach all skills, including bowing, intonation, and expressive dynamics, to develop individual artistry. Ensemble performances teach students teamwork, communication, and musical knowledge. The curriculum instills a profound awareness of stage etiquette, encompassing stage presence, audience interaction, concert preparation, and professional politeness. This immersive experience makes students skilled violinists and poised, confident performers who can succeed in various musical settings.

The VOP continues to be taught in a group setting, offering students the chance to volunteer, perform in the community, collaborate with peers, and further develop their violin skills.
